Core Insights - The article highlights the advancements in the Chengdu Aircraft Industrial Group's "black light factory," which utilizes advanced manufacturing technologies to enhance efficiency and quality in aerospace equipment production [1][2][3]. Group 1: Manufacturing Efficiency - The "black light factory" operates with significantly reduced labor, requiring only one-tenth of the original workforce to maintain 24/7 operations, showcasing a shift from a 2:1 or 3:1 worker-to-machine ratio to an average of 3 to 4 machines per worker [1][3]. - The factory has achieved a 96% equipment availability rate through predictive maintenance, which has transformed the production process by minimizing downtime and enhancing responsiveness to production demands [3][4]. Group 2: Flexible Assembly - The factory has developed a highly flexible assembly model that allows for the adaptation to various aircraft components and production requirements, enabling real-time adjustments to assembly processes [4]. - This flexibility is supported by advanced human-machine collaboration, allowing the assembly line to dynamically adjust to changes in production tasks and worker input [4]. Group 3: Intelligent Inspection - The implementation of AI technologies in the inspection process has led to a digital inspection rate of 82%, significantly improving the efficiency and traceability of quality control measures [5]. - Automated measurement systems have streamlined the inspection workflow, allowing for rapid data collection and reporting, which enhances overall product quality and reduces manual labor [5].
